Fuse Help

Our fuse keeps popping and blows. How do we fix this?

Re: Fuse Help

If it's for the compressor, replace it with a 20A Circuit breaker.

If it's not for the compressor, find the short! Trace your wiring on the output of the Spike and make sure they never touch anywhere down the line.

Re: Fuse Help

Quote:
Originally Posted by the man View Post
We are using a 40amp for the compressor spike it pops any other ones
Is it a 40A fuse or 40A circuit breaker.

If it is a 40A fuse (red automotive) replace it with a 20A circuit breaker
If it if a 40 A circuit breaker, first of all how did you fit it into the Spike? Replace it with a 20A breaker.

The compressor will work with a 20A circuit breaker. Even if it does trip momentarily the breaker will reset and it will work. If it doesnt work then your compressor may be bad or it is mounted somewhere with insufficient shock absorbing. I suspect you are using a 40A fuse and replacing it with a breaker is better anyway. Re: Fuse Help

Try using a different 20 Amp breaker; they are kinda funny the way that they handle peak loads and maybe it just wasn't sitting right. The compressor draws high power at start up but shouldn't be drawing high power continuously - remember there is also a 20 amp breaker on the PD Board to the Spike. Check your complete wiring circuit - fix the problem, not the symptom (which is the breaker popping).
